Alien Swarm tweaks allow first person view, more
Make an experience suited to your tastes
Like any game using Valve's Source engine, there are a lot of internal settings users can change through the developer console. Alien Swarm is no different with plenty of commands to change how you play the game and its appearance.
If you don't know how to enable the console, go to Options, then Keyboard/Mouse, and click the checkbox that says "Enable Developer Console". Now you can open up the console mid-game or in menus by pressing the "~" key.
Want to play the game in a first-person view? Type firstperson, asw_hide_marine 1, and asw_controls 0 while you have the console open (try experimenting with them one at a time to see their effect). This is the result:
It's like Left 4 Dead with aliens.
There are a lot more settings to be found in the source so change as much as you like to your tastes. If you're new to console commands, just know that the "Server Side" commands provided are considered cheats so only those playing offline or server admins can change them.
